Origin & Cultural Significance
Kuvira has its origins in Sanskrit, the classical language of ancient India that has influenced numerous modern South Asian languages. As a Sanskrit-derived name, it belongs to the broader Hindu naming tradition where names are often chosen for their meaningful qualities rather than just phonetic appeal. While not among the most common Sanskrit names, Kuvira appears in regional Indian contexts and has been documented in linguistic references. The name gained wider recognition in the 21st century through its use for a character in the animated series The Legend of Korra, though its historical usage predates this popular culture reference.
